    On Friday, Yahoo added to its claims of infringement against Facebook, in addition to denying that it violates any of the patents named in the social network’s countersuit.

    The additional claims involve the “System and Method to Determine Validity of and Interaction on a Network” and the “System and Method Allowing Advertisers to Manage Search Listings in Pay for Placement Search System Using Grouping,” which the company says is violated by Facebook Ads.

    In the filing, Yahoo also hits out at Facebook for asserting patents in-suit that it purchased from other companies — notable, as Facebook recently purchased 650 patents from Microsoft. The patents, originally held by AOL, were viewed as a way for the social network to better defend itself against infringement claims.
